Bat Cave No. 1

description Bat Cave No. 1 Overview

Bat Cave No. 1 is a notable lava tube in New Mexico's El Malpais National Monument, serving as an important historical site and bat habitat.

help Bat Cave No. 1 FAQ

Where is Bat Cave No. 1?

Bat Cave No. 1 is in El Malpais National Monument in New Mexico. It is part of the area's extensive volcanic lava-tube landscape.

Why is Bat Cave No. 1 important?

The cave is both a historical site and bat habitat. Its name reflects the importance of bats in the cave's natural history.

What kind of cave is Bat Cave No. 1?

It is a lava tube formed by volcanic flows, not a limestone cave. El Malpais contains many such passages because basaltic lava once covered the region.

Can anyone enter Bat Cave No. 1?

Access to lava tubes in El Malpais can be restricted to protect bats and sensitive cave conditions. Visitors should check current National Park Service rules before entering any named cave.
